interBat - Sensory and cognitive ecology of species interactions in bat communities

interBat - Sensory and cognitive ecology of species interactions in bat communities

In January 2012 a new project was launched by Dr. Björn Siemers, head of the Sensory Ecology research group, who was awarded a five year ERC Starting Grant worth 1.5 million EUR by the European Research Council (ERC).

The project addresses two fundamental questions concerning the interaction of animal species: What ‘knowledge’ do animals have about the behaviour and ecology of other animal species? And do differences in sensory ability play a role in mediating resource partitioning between coexisting, potentially competing animal species?

The central commitment of this project is to study animal behaviour using an experimental and hypothesis driven approach. The model system will be a European community of bat species. In 2012 and 2013 we want to develop automated experimental stations that can be deployed in the field. These stations will autonomously interact with wild animals, run individualized experiments and gather high-quality data for hypothesis testing.


The project will be hosted by the Max Planck Institute for Ornithology in Seewiesen. Field work will be conducted at the TBRS in Bulgaria in cooperation with Bulgarian researchers and students.
